Output edfb2dff3dfd9eaa2b0db77d4e8044b3d61e13ae1b67fe553c09c6745d75323c:3

value
1296822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83189acf78014a943e4d64b312b6d37bf1d81041 OP_EQUAL
address
3DeBvEshgb8d5J31jwuZxqoVqLsp9V3g5N
transaction
edfb2dff3dfd9eaa2b0db77d4e8044b3d61e13ae1b67fe553c09c6745d75323c
confirmations
262285
spent
true